About Yana

Yana Gaykov is a licensed clinical social worker (LCSW) based in New York with 20 years of professional experience. She has helped people navigate stress and anxiety, relationship difficulties, parenting challenges, and depression, offering steady support as they work through obstacles.

Yana approaches each person as the expert of their own story and focuses on identifying and building the strengths clients already possess. She recognizes that seeking a more fulfilling and happier life requires courage and she aims to walk alongside clients through that process. Her work emphasizes collaboration, respect, and practical attention to the issues clients bring to therapy.

With two decades in practice, Yana combines experience and a strengths-based perspective to support individuals and families as they face change, manage emotional struggles, and pursue clearer goals for wellbeing.

Evidence-Based Approaches and Online Support

Yana often uses skills-based, evidence-supported techniques that focus on managing stress and anxiety - these approaches teach practical tools for coping with overwhelming emotions and daily pressures. She also employs relational, strengths-oriented work to address relationship and parenting concerns - this helps clients explore patterns in how they relate to others and develop healthier ways of connecting. When trauma or difficult life events arise, Yana draws on trauma-aware, evidence-informed methods to help clients process experiences at a pace that feels manageable.

Finding the right therapeutic approach is part of the process and Yana works collaboratively with each person to determine the best fit based on their needs, goals, and preferences. She tailors the method and pace of work to what feels most useful for the client, inviting ongoing feedback and adjustment.

Online sessions by video call, phone, live chat, or text-based messaging offer flexibility that can make consistent care easier to maintain. These options allow clients to schedule support around work, family, and other responsibilities, and to access licensed professionals from different settings when in-person visits are not possible or convenient.
